In the days between World War II and the space race, a team of scientists attempted to inspire public sentiment about human spaceflight. It was the perfect alignment of science and science-fiction, led by a former Nazi rocket scientist and a temperamental artist. Hear how "Man Will Conquer Space Soon," starting in Collier's magazine on March 22, 1952, got people to look forward to a trip to the moon and beyond.
